## Values

- Hex: `#a083d2`
- RGB: rgb(160, 131, 210)
- HSL: hsl(262, 47%, 67%)
- OKLCH: oklch(0.668 0.118 300.1)
- Relative luminance: 0.2836
- Nearest named color: Petrified Purple (#9c87c1, Δ 3.083) — https://brandsweets.com/colors/petrified-purple
- Moods: cool, modern

## Contrast (WCAG 2.x, as text)

- On white (#ffffff): 3.15:1 — AA fail, AA-large pass, AAA fail. Fix: AA: text → #8662c6 (4.59:1); AA: background → #292929 (4.62:1); AAA: text → #6940b0 (7.09:1)
- On black (#000000): 6.67:1 — AA pass, AA-large pass, AAA fail. Fix: AAA: text → #a68bd5 (7.28:1)
